Why spirituality is important

Why spirituality is important

Consider the shifting territory of your daily life. The need to:

* cope with increasing change – in career and in life
* understand and thrive through life’s increasing complexity, and
* make sense of your cross-cultural, cross-generational and cross-role experiences.

Spirituality provides you with awareness and understanding of your inner and outer landscape – it enhances how you understand yourself, your life and your place within society.

Benefits of spirituality

The depth of a person’s spiritual experience has significant implications – in both their personal and professional lives. Previous studies have already found that people actively pursuing a spiritual life experience a:

* greater understanding and perceived ‘control’ over their life
* higher personal resilience, and
* increased social support.

Further, in a work and professional context a person’s commitment to spiritual practice does influence their level of:

* commitment to career goals
* motivation and job satisfaction, and
* willingness to demonstrate loyalty, respect, and active participation with others in their work.

When considering your spirituality

Spirituality is inclusive and comprehensive. In other words, it should be accepting of all of the world's religions and spiritual approaches without abandoning your own essentials. According to spiritual philosopher, Ken Wilbur, spirituality is integral by nature and, therefore, must encompasses a reflection of your:

1. Interior/Self – your subjective, phenomenological and inner spiritual experiences
2. Exterior/Self – your practices/behaviours for considering and developing your spirituality
3. Interior/Collective – the belief and values systems, culture and worldviews in which your inner ‘view’ of spirituality is immersed, and
4. Exterior/Collective – the social systems, institutions and environments in which you consider and practice your spirituality.

When engaged in your spiritual journey, it is the consideration of each of these elements that facilitates spiritual growth.
